轻松同时使用或切换多个搜索引擎

如果你发现在搜索引擎间来回切换是一件很麻烦的事情,虽然主流浏览器都支持自己添加搜索引擎,在URL栏或专用搜索栏搜索,但总不如人意。

不过,也有跨浏览器的,内建了几十个我们常用的搜索引擎(也包括查词、购物、娱乐等搜索),并且可在不同浏览器之间导出和导入自定义搜索引擎数据的方法。

而且是浏览器扩展插件、网页版免安装使用两种形式。但要用扩展才能轻松使用连续点击搜索的特性。

看看当前它的内建引擎收录状况:

中英混搭部分

  • 🌐General: Bing | Google | Yahoo Search | Yandex | DuckDuckGo | StartPage | Ecosia | Qwant | Findx | MetaGer | Swisscows
  • 💻Programing: Github | MDN | StackExchange | AlternativeTo | Chocolatey | Scoop Search Apps | Cygwin packages | Homebrew | Docker Hub | Flathub | Snapcraft | NixOS | GNU Guix packages
  • 📱Mobile Apps: Google Play Apps | F-Droid | iTunes Apps (Google) | IzzyOnDroid F-Droid | APKDL | APKMirror | APK-DL | APKPure | Freeapk | AppsApk | Android Picks | AndroidAPKsFree
  • 📺Multimedia: Google | Youtube
  • 🔠Translates: Cambridge Dictionary | Google Translate
  • 📑Knowledge: Web of Science | EI | IEEE Xplore | Google Scholar | Bing Academic | Wkipedia
  • 🛒Shopping: Amazon | TMall

中文

除了以上各语言通用的内容外,大术专搜(Big Search)还提供(且可能是惟一)针对中文用户的内容。并仍在不断添加中~

  • 🌐通用搜索: 百度、搜狗搜索、360搜索
  • 📱手机应用: iTunes Apps (百度)
  • 📺音视频图: 百度、哔哩哔哩、网易云音乐
  • 🔠百国语译: 有道词典、百度翻译、必应词典
  • 📑资料论文: 中国知网、万方数据、CSSCI、百度学术、维基百科
  • 🀄漢言華語: 汉典、古今文字集成、萌典、粵典、CantoDict、中國哲學書電子化計劃、漢籍(漢リポ)
  • 🛒网上购物: 淘宝天猫、京东、唯品会、当当网、苏宁易购
  • 📈财经走势: 英为财情、雪球、非小号、AICoin

可以看到,既然Github、Stack Overflow这些网站都收录了,这个东西自然也已经开源在Github上了:
https://github.com/garywill/BigSearch

来说一下内部使用的技术

内置的超过50个引擎,以及给用户添加的自定义私人引擎功能,都是通过JS解释JSON数据,之后进行DOM节点绘制、点击按钮后发送GET和POST请求实现的。简单的JSON引擎数据如:

{
    "百度": "https://www.baidu.com/s?wd={0}",
    "Google": "https://www.google.com/search?q={0}",
    "Yahoo Search": "https://search.yahoo.com/search?q={0}"
}

以上String引擎只支持GET,使用POST method的引擎就要换成完整形式的JSON Object形式来描述一个引擎,如:

"yahoo": {
   "dname": "Yahoo Search",
    "addr": "https://search.yahoo.com",
    "action": "https://search.yahoo.com/search",
    "kw_key": "q"
}

如果是POST method则加个"method": "post"

总之,任何引擎都可以使用以上方式描述。其他的如Open Search描述方式、Firefox profile描述方式都比不上这个工具提供的描述方式这样全面。详细需要看源代码页面的说明:
https://github.com/garywill/BigSearch

因此,安装浏览器扩展后,使用此工具比直接使用URL栏或搜索栏更pro

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值